Obituary for Robert (Bob) John Barclay

Barclay, Robert John (Bob)
Passed away with his family by his side on Tuesday, November 14, 2017 at the age of 56. Beloved husband of 37 years to Wanda Barclay (nee Skinn). Dear father of Ryan (Angela, son Maxwell and a daughter on the way), Linsey (daughter Claire), and Lauren. Survived by his parents, Stewart Sr. and Elizabeth Barclay, his sister Jacqueline Shantz (Paul) and his brother Stewart Jr. (Kelly). Fondly remembered by his wife’s family, in-laws Henry and Doreen Skinn, brothers Wayne Skinn (Alison) and Ray Skinn (Cathy) and sister Sandra Davidson. His a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ces and nephews will all miss him.
Bob was born and raised in Glasgow, Scotland then moved to Canada in 1973 with the Barclay clan. He met the love of his life Wanda and married in 1980. He was passionate about his career, starting out in the maintenance department at the Breslau Oil Re-Refinery, which then changed ownership to the Safety-Kleen Services Inc., where he became Plant Manager. He worked between Canada and the US as a great leader and was well respected by his colleagues. He spent his last couple of years working as a consultant on the start-up of another oil re-refinery plant in Indiana, US. He had to put aside his career to take care of his health which became the biggest battle of his life...he fought hard until the end.
